Finance Review Summary — Licensing Dispute, Hallowick Components

The dispute with Tessmark Industrial over the Corvid-9 licence remains unresolved. Our exposure is estimated at mid six figures, with accrued provisions booked in Q3. Counsel advises settlement is likelier than arbitration, and cash-flow impact would fall in the next fiscal year. The finance team should note the planning implication recorded below.

confidential, hawif-kagup: Only 16 of the 552 pilot accounts renewed Ralix, so a churn review is set for November 1. Quenysox Group is in early talks to buy Ralethix Partners for about $63.3 million.

**CI note: timezone weirdness in report exports**

Heads up, support folks — if a customer says their Ledgerpine export shows times shifted by a few hours, it's probably the CI image. The export workers got rebuilt last week and the base image defaults to UTC, while older workers used the account's locale. Fix is rolling out; meanwhile tell customers the data itself is fine, just the display offset. Affected exports carry the build token shown below.

build token for bajof-tahop: htk4_a981

## Changelog — Font vendoring defaults changed

As of this release, the Bracken UI build no longer fetches third-party fonts at build time. All typefaces used by the Lanternwell suite are now vendored into the repo under a dedicated assets directory, and the fetch step is skipped by default. If you're onboarding, nothing to install — the fonts travel with the checkout. The build flags controlling this behavior are listed below.

settings of hadup-yafog:
LAMAEL_PIN=3761
LAMAEL_TENANT=istmir
LAMAEL_METRICS_HOST=metrics.lamael.plorvasys.test
LAMAEL_SEAL=seal_8ea68500
LAMAEL_STANDBY_TEAM=fraok

For contractors joining the Mistlewood digest project: the batch email scheduler's old setting `DIGEST_CRON_WINDOW` has been renamed to `DIGEST_DISPATCH_WINDOW` to match the dispatcher service's terminology. The old name still works but logs a deprecation warning and will be removed in 4.0. Please update any env files you've copied from earlier branches, and double-check the timezone suffix — several missed digests last quarter traced back to that. The dispatcher also authenticates to the mail relay, so your env file needs this line:

secret setting of bageg-bagag: ARCHIVE_KEY3=e2f